Job Description

About the Role Join the ServiceChannel Finance team as a Financial Analyst (FP&A) and help shape how we plan, forecast, and understand our business.

This role goes beyond traditional reporting—you’ll partner directly with business leaders to translate data into insights, build driver-based models, and influence key strategic decisions.

You’ll play a critical role in forecasting performance, improving processes, and scaling financial operations in a high-growth SaaS environment. What You’ll Do

• Partner with cross-functional leaders to support monthly close, forecasting, and annual planning

• Build and enhance driver-based financial models across bookings, revenue, headcount, and expenses

• Analyze variances (Actual vs. Forecast) and deliver clear, actionable insights on trends, risks, and opportunities

• Develop and track KPIs tied to core business drivers, improving visibility into performance

• Support revenue, utilization, and churn analysis to deepen business understanding

• Prepare exec-ready reporting and presentations for finance leadership

• Identify and implement process improvements and automation opportunities to scale FP&A capabilities

• Collaborate cross-functionally to improve data integrity, reporting accuracy, and decision support Qualifications/Requirements

•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or related field

• 1+ years of experience in FP&A, financial analysis, or similar role

• Strong Excel skills; experience with financial systems (NetSuite, planning tools) preferred

• Ability to connect details to the big picture and communicate insights clearly

• Analytical mindset with a focus on business drivers and performance improvement

• Self-starter who thrives in a fast-paced, evolving environment Successful candidate

• Experience with driver-based planning or SaaS metrics (ARR, churn, NDR, etc.)

• Passion for automation, systems, and scalable finance processes
